Wyndham Hotels & Resorts reported strong Q3 2022 results, with global RevPAR growing by 12% and system-wide rooms increasing by 4%. The company raised its full-year 2022 outlook and increased its share repurchase authorization by $400 million.
Global RevPAR increased by 12% compared to Q3 2021 in constant currency.
System-wide rooms grew by 4% year-over-year, with 1% growth in the U.S. and 9% internationally.
The development pipeline expanded by 10% year-over-year to 212,000 rooms.
Hotel Franchising segment revenues grew by 9% year-over-year.
The Company is updating its outlook as follows: Year-over-year rooms growth~4%, Year-over-year global RevPAR growth 14 - 16%, Fee-related and other revenues $1.33 - $1.34 billion, Adjusted EBITDA $636 - $644 million, Adjusted net income $349 - $354 million, Adjusted diluted EPS $3.84 - $3.89, Free cash flow conversion rate ~55%
